[PATCH 0/9] More virtio hardening

From: Jason Wang <hidden>
Date: 2021-09-13 05:54:19
Also in: lkml

Hi All:

This series treis to do more hardening for virito.

patch 1 validates the num_queues for virio-blk device.
patch 2-4 validates max_nr_ports for virito-console device.
patch 5-7 harden virtio-pci interrupts to make sure no exepcted
interrupt handler is tiggered. If this makes sense we can do similar
things in other transport drivers.
patch 8-9 validate used ring length.

Smoking test on blk/net with packed=on/off and iommu_platform=on/off.

Please review.
